Tactical Rivalries and Strategic Matchup Evolution

The dynamic between the Minnesota Twins and the Philadelphia Phillies represents a clash of distinct organizational philosophies. The Twins historically rely on a high-contact offense and a disciplined bullpen to maintain their hold on the AL Central, while the Phillies continue to leverage their veteran-heavy core and high-velocity starting rotation to dominate the NL East.

In the 2026 season, scouting reports emphasize the importance of situational hitting when these two clubs cross paths. For the Twins, the goal is often neutralizing the Phillies' home-field advantage at Citizens Bank Park, where the atmosphere can often disrupt opposing pitchers' rhythms. Conversely, when playing at Target Field, the Phillies must adapt to the spacious outfield and wind conditions that often neutralize power-heavy lineups. Strategic analysts are paying close attention to how manager rotations handle these high-stakes series, as the limited head-to-head opportunities mean that every game functions as a microcosm of the team's broader seasonal weaknesses and strengths.

Digital access continues to evolve in 2026. Viewers can stream these contests through official league platforms, such as MLB.tv, which remains the primary source for out-of-market broadcasts. Local sports networks covering both the Minneapolis and Philadelphia markets offer pre-game analysis and live post-game breakdowns. For those attending in person, digital ticketing and mobile-only entry are the standard at both ballparks, requiring fans to download the appropriate team app prior to arrival to streamline stadium access.
